What are Abhenry and Megahenry

Definition of Abhenry

The unit Abhenry is a magnetic unit of inductance in the centimeter-gram-second (cgs) system of units. Named after the physicist Joseph Henry, it represents the amount of inductance required to induce an electromotive force of one abvolt when the current changes at the rate of one abampere per second. The Abhenry is equivalent to 10^-9 Henry in the International System of Units (SI). Commonly used in theoretical physics and electromechanical systems, it helps quantify the relationship between magnetic fields and electric currents in circuits.

Definition of Megahenry

The Megahenry is a unit of inductance in the International System of Units (SI), symbolized as MH. It represents one million henries and is commonly used in measuring large inductance values in electrical circuits. 1 Megahenry equals 1,000,000 henries. This unit is essential for understanding the behavior of inductive components in power transmission, transformers, and other high-power applications. By quantifying how much an electric current is opposed by a magnetic field, the Megahenry plays a crucial role in the analysis and design of electrical and electronic systems.

Conversion of Abhenry to Megahenry

1 abH = 0.00000000001 MH
1 MH = 100000000000 abH

Example 1:
convert 5000 abH to MH:
5000 abH = 5000 × 0.00000000001 MH = 0.00000005 MH

Example 2:
convert 3500 abH to MH:
3500 abH = 3500 × 0.00000000001 MH = 0.000000035 MH
